XL acrylic painting of holly hock blossoms in blues, white and terracotta, from the Floral series

Angie Brooksby-Arcangioli is an contemporary artist living on the French Riviera, a professional artist since 1990. Her paintings are in collections worldwide. She exhibited in art fairs and galleries in Luxembourg, Paris, NYC, Amsterdam, Cologne, Bruxelles, Saint Tropez, Cannes, Marseilles, Beruit, Honfleur, Milan, Rome, Florence… In 2025, the Michelin Guide Vert Côte d'Azur published a full page on her atelier-gallery, the Galerie Massillon. In 2001 she was interviewed live in Florence for NBC. She received prizes, and scholarships for painting, photography and sculpture.

What they say about me:
"Virginia Salaorni of Street level Gallery in Florence says Brooksby demonstrates mastery of mixed media combined with a highly personal approach to colour. Her use of colour is mature and rich, and not decorative; the pictorial material generates visual depth. The handling of space is effective too, with dynamic, well-balanced compositions.
One of the most successful aspects of Brooksby-Arcangioli’s work is her ability to convey visual sensuality through colour itself. The paint, applied either thickly or in translucent layers, invites an almost tactile experience, making the works engaging at different viewing distances. The inclusion of gold and silver leaf not only gives a precious and decorative appearance, but also introduces iridescent light reflections that vary with natural or artificial light, making the experience of the work dynamic and alive. There is also a refined awareness of composition; the distribution of colour masses across the surface reveals an underlying structure that is solid yet never random"

Often I paint outside en plein air because the colors in nature are my inspiration.
I am a professional painter who was born in New York and holds a degree in figurative sculpture from MICA in Maryland, USA. I lived 20 + years painting the Tuscan countryside, 14 years in Paris painting Contemporary Urban. And currently 5 on the French Riviera.
